- İş yazılımı (B2B SaaS) geliştirmek için açık kaynak kimlik doğrulama (giriş/yetkilendirme) altyapı platformu
- Çok kiracılı yapı, API-first servisler ve bulut ortamları için optimize edilmiştir; belirli bir dil veya framework'e bağımlı olmadığından her türlü teknoloji yığınıyla entegre olabilir
Başlıca özellikler
- Özelleştirilebilir barındırılan giriş sayfası: Önceden yapılandırılmış UI sunar; marka uyarlamaları yapılabilir, giriş yöntemleri konsoldan birkaç tıklamayla eklenip kaldırılabilir
- B2B çok kiracılık: Müşteri organizasyonları (tenant) bazında yönetici yetkileri ve kullanıcı yönetimi, ayrıca şirket bazında özelleştirilmiş kimlik doğrulama politikaları uygulanabilir
- Kullanıcı Impersonation'ı (vekil giriş): Yöneticiler/geliştiriciler doğrudan kullanıcı olarak giriş yaparak hata ayıklama ve destek sağlayabilir
- Self-service ayar sayfası: Müşteriler organizasyon üyelerini davet etme, giriş ayarlarını yönetme gibi işlemleri kendileri yapabilir
- Magic link (e-posta ile giriş): Kod yazmadan e-posta bağlantısıyla giriş desteği
- Sosyal giriş: Google, GitHub, Microsoft entegrasyonu
- SAML SSO: Kurumsal SSO entegrasyonu, ek kod yazmaya gerek yok
- SCIM (Enterprise Directory Sync): Dizin senkronizasyonu (provisioning) desteği
- Rol tabanlı erişim kontrolü (RBAC): UI yerleşik gelir; uygulama içinde yalnızca yetki kontrol fonksiyonunu (
hasPermission) uygulamak yeterlidir
- Çok faktörlü kimlik doğrulama (MFA/2FA): Çeşitli iki aşamalı doğrulama seçenekleri; müşteri bazında zorunlu olup olmayacağı ayarlanabilir
- Passkey ve WebAuthn: Kod yazmadan Passkey ile giriş desteği. Touch ID, YubiKey gibi tüm passkey platformları
- TOTP (OTP uygulaması): Kod yazmadan Google Authenticator benzeri zaman tabanlı tek kullanımlık parola doğrulaması desteği
- API anahtarı yönetimi: API anahtarı oluşturma, yönetim ve kimlik doğrulama kontrolü için UI sağlar
- Kullanıcı daveti: Yöneticiler/mevcut kullanıcılar ekip arkadaşlarını davet edebilir
- Webhook'lar: Gerçek zamanlı veri senkronizasyonu
Çeşitli SDK desteği
- Frontend: React SDK sunar; uygulamanın tamamını
<TesseralProvider> ile sarmaladığınızda kimlik doğrulama/token yenileme/giriş geçitleme gibi işlemler otomatikleşir
- Backend: Express, Flask, Go gibi başlıca backend framework'leri için SDK desteği; middleware biçiminde kimlik doğrulama işlemi
- Kimlik doğrulama token'larını otomatik doğrulama, kullanıcı bilgisi/organizasyon ID'si/yetkiler gibi verileri çıkarmaya yönelik fonksiyonlar sağlar
Henüz yorum yok.